About 1-phenyl-4-propan-2-ylsulfanylbenzene

1-phenyl-4-propan-2-ylsulfanylbenzene (PubChem CID 15570401) has the molecular formula C15H16S and a molecular weight of 228.36 g/mol. Its IUPAC name is 1-phenyl-4-propan-2-ylsulfanylbenzene.
